Fan enthusiasm for the current bodybuilding season has rapidly intensified as the 2024 Tupelo Pro took over Tupelo, MS from Aug. 8–9. This contest, a prestigious 2025 Mr. Olympia qualifier, featured athletes from four categories: Classic Physique, Figure, Women’s Physique, and Wellness.
The winners of each contest become eligible to compete at the 2025 Olympia in Las Vegas, NV, on Oct. 9–12. If the winner previously qualified, no qualification will be awarded.
